Why is Camera Access Denied on Omegle?
There are several reasons why camera access might be denied on Omegle:
- Browser restrictions: Your browser may be blocking camera access due to security settings or outdated software.
- Device permissions: Your device may not have granted Omegle the necessary permissions to access the camera.
- Camera issues: Your camera may be malfunctioning or not properly configured.
Allowing Camera Access on Omegle: A Step-by-Step Guide
To allow camera access on Omegle, follow these steps:
Step 1: Check Your Browser Settings
Ensure that your browser is up-to-date and configured to allow camera access. Here’s how:
- Google Chrome:
- Click the three vertical dots in the top right corner of the browser.
- Select “Settings” from the drop-down menu.
- Scroll down to the “Advanced” section.
- Click on “Site settings.”
- Locate the “Camera” section and ensure that the toggle switch is set to “Ask before accessing (recommended)” or “Allow.”
- Mozilla Firefox:
- Click the three horizontal lines in the top right corner of the browser.
- Select “Options” from the drop-down menu.
- Click on the “Privacy & Security” tab.
- Scroll down to the “Permissions” section.
- Ensure that the “Camera” option is set to “Allow.”
Step 2: Grant Device Permissions
Grant Omegle the necessary permissions to access your camera:
- Windows:
- Click on the Start menu and select “Settings.”
- Click on “Privacy.”
- Select “Camera” from the left menu.
- Ensure that the toggle switch under “Allow apps to access your camera” is set to “On.”
- Locate Omegle in the list of apps and ensure that the toggle switch is set to “On.”
- Mac:
- Click on the Apple menu and select “System Preferences.”
- Click on “Security & Privacy.”
- Select the “Camera” tab.
- Ensure that the checkbox next to Omegle is selected.
Step 3: Configure Your Camera Settings
Ensure that your camera is properly configured and functioning:
- Check your camera’s physical connection: Ensure that your camera is properly connected to your device.
- Update your camera drivers: Outdated camera drivers may cause issues with camera access. Update your drivers to the latest version.
- Disable and re-enable your camera: Sometimes, disabling and re-enabling your camera can resolve connectivity issues.

How do I allow camera access on Omegle for the first time?
To allow camera access on Omegle for the first time, you’ll need to follow a few simple steps. First, navigate to the Omegle website and click on the “Video” button to initiate a video chat. You’ll then be prompted to allow Omegle to access your camera and microphone. Click on the “Allow” button to grant permission.
Once you’ve granted permission, Omegle will be able to access your camera and connect you with other users. You may be prompted to configure your camera settings or select a specific camera device if you have multiple cameras connected to your device.
Why is Omegle not detecting my camera?
If Omegle is not detecting your camera, there could be a few reasons for this issue. First, make sure that your camera is properly connected to your device and that it’s turned on. You can also try restarting your device or closing and reopening the Omegle website to see if this resolves the issue.
Another possible reason for this issue is that your browser or device settings may be blocking Omegle from accessing your camera. Check your browser settings or device permissions to ensure that Omegle has the necessary permissions to access your camera.

Can I use Omegle without allowing camera access?
While it’s technically possible to use Omegle without allowing camera access, this will limit your ability to participate in video chats. Omegle’s video chat feature requires camera access to connect you with other users, so if you don’t grant permission, you won’t be able to engage in video conversations.
However, you can still use Omegle’s text chat feature without allowing camera access. This allows you to communicate with other users via text messages, but you won’t be able to participate in video chats.
